The CJMCU-MCP4725 is an I2C controlled Digital-to-Analog converter (DAC).
A DAC allows you to send analog signal, such as a sine wave, from a digital source,
such as the I2C interface on the Arduino microcontroller.
Digital to analog converters are great for
sound generation, musical instruments, and many other creative projects!
This version of the CJMCU-MCP4725 Breakout fixes a few issues with the board including the IC footprint, the I2C pinout,
changes the overall board dimensions to better fit your projects, and a few more minor tweaks.
This board breaks out each pin you will need to access and
use the MCP4725 including GND and Signal OUT pins for connecting to an oscilloscope or
any other device you need to hook up to the board.
Also on board are SCL, SDA, VCC, and another GND for your basic I2C pinout.

Features:
12-bit resolution
I2C Interface (Standard, Fast, and High-Speed supported)
Small package
2.7V to 5.5V supply
Internal EEPROM to store settings
